Originally Posted by Full_Tilt_Boogie
Check your grounds. High RPM vibration can make a loose connection them lose contact when they would otherwise be okay.
+1 on the grounds
Not that they shake loose but the added current at high RPMs makes bigger voltage loss over the oxide.
After killing a lot of stuff with poor grounds a fat braid will be installed before I get the engine back in.

Add a jumper-cable between the chassis (or maybe the battery negative terminal) and the engine and make a test?
